Latest Patents
One of Gent's latest patents is the "Pendulum Rolling Resistant Test." This innovative device utilizes a pendulum to assess the rolling resistance of materials. It features a rolling unit that contacts the material being tested, an assembly that initiates pendulum motion, and a mechanism for measuring the amplitude of the pendulum's motion over time. The rate at which the amplitude decreases serves as a measure of the material's rolling resistance.
Another significant patent is the "Eccentric Mounted Rotor for Mixing Solids and Liquid in a Chamber." This device is designed for mixing liquids, solids, or their combinations, particularly focusing on viscous liquids and polymeric solids. It consists of a cylindrical mixing chamber and a rotor shaped like a convex-convex lens. The rotor is variably positionable, allowing it to rotate eccentrically within the mixing chamber. This design enhances the mixing efficiency, as the rotor can occupy between 28% to 100% of the chamber's volume.
Career Highlights
Throughout his career, Alan N Gent has worked with prominent organizations, including The Goodyear Tire & Rubber Company and The University of Akron. His experience in these institutions has contributed to his expertise in material science and engineering.
Collaborations
Gent has collaborated with notable individuals in his field, including George Samuel Fielding-Russell and William Allen Arnold. These partnerships have further enriched his work and innovations.
